Police from the 102nd Precinct are looking for a moped-riding thief who targeted women twice last month.
Police say the first incident occurred at around 2:35 p.m. on Monday, July 14, when a stranger on a purple moped approached a 59-year-old victim in front of a market at 101-16 77th St. in Ozone Park. He then snatched her purse off her arm before riding off in an unknown direction. The woman’s purse contained a cellphone, $160 in cash, and two credit cards, police said.
The perpetrator struck again a week later, just before 7:30 p.m. on Monday, July 21, when he rode up behind an 18-year-old woman on the purple moped on Lefferts Boulevard near Metropolitan Avenue in Kew Gardens. He forcibly removed her shopping bag before speeding off in an unknown direction
